Position Overview:
The Senior Database Administrator (DBA) will be responsible for overseeing all activities related to the administration, design, implementation, and maintenance of large-scale computerized databases within a client/server environment. This role involves projecting long-term requirements, ensuring data integrity, security, and availability, and providing expert guidance and support on database systems. The DBA will design and support complex databases, perform quality controls, audits, and system integration, and work closely with other information systems managers to meet organizational needs.
Key Responsibilities:
-Plan, design, develop, and maintain enterprise-level databases in a client/server environment.
-Project long-term database requirements in coordination with other management teams.
-Conduct quality control, auditing, and performance tuning of databases to ensure accuracy, security, and optimal operation.
-Advise users on database access, security, and best practices for efficient data use.
-Design, implement, and maintain databases considering JCL, access methods, access time, device allocation, validation checks, organizational structure, protection, security, and documentation.
-Develop and support database programming, including front-end/back-end development using SQL and other relevant languages.
-Maintain database dictionaries, monitor standards, design files, storage, and facilitate system integration through database design.
-Perform database security management, backups, recovery, and troubleshooting.
-Develop procedures and documentation for database management and support ongoing improvement initiatives.
-Conduct system audits and enforce database management standards and procedures.
